11.8 percent of Potomac State College of West Virginia University students played sports on university teams in 2017-2018
In 2017-2018, 11.8 percent of Potomac State College of West Virginia University students participated in collegiate sports, according to data made available by the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ES).

Cost of college went up for all students at Potomac State College of West Virginia University
In-state tuition and fees rose 5.6 percent for 2018-19 at Potomac State College of West Virginia University, according to recent data from the U.S. Department of Education.

Potomac State College of West Virginia University enrolls 1,340 undergrads
At Potomac State College of West Virginia University, 91 percent of undergraduate students are traditional students - age 24 or younger - and 56 percent are female, according to the latest disclosure from the U.S. Department of Education.

Graduates earn 216 degrees from Potomac State College of West Virginia University
About 41.2 percent of the 216 degrees and certificates handed out by Potomac State College of West Virginia University in 2017-18 were to students in liberal arts and sciences, general studies and humanities programs, making them the most popular programs that year, according to the latest disclosure from the U.S. Department of Education.
